Surface Nanocrystallization of Stainless Steel with ZAF Method and SEM Technique

چکیده

From a nano electronic circuit designer’s point of view the growth of ultrathin film in the ultra high vacuum chamber (UHVC) would imply better stainless steel structure. ZAF method and SEM (scanning Electron Microscopy) technique are used to realize surface nano crystallizafion on an stailness steel sample. The as-welded condition of UHVC is also studied to see if this chamber can prevent weld "hot cracking". The aim is to find a way to synthesis a good and uniform content elements of stainless steel . UHVC with iron-based alloys containing a minimum of 10 percent chromium (Cr) with 20 percent Ni , Mn and Si can keep UHV conditions down to 10 10 Torr. 15 18
